### Runbook: Report export timezone mismatches (Glimmerfield)

If a customer reports that exported totals differ from the dashboard, check whether their report schedule predates the March cutover — older schedules still render in server-local time rather than the account timezone. Re-saving the schedule fixes it. Before escalating, confirm the export worker is running with the expected timezone settings shown below.

config for kadup-kajog:
[raldor]
host = raldor.tolvaqworks.internal
user = raldor_svc
database = raldor_prod

MEMO — To all branch managers, from Central Marketing, Quillbrook Housewares

Team, the launch plan for the Emberline cookware range is locked in. Soft launch hits the Darnley and Westhollow branches first, with the full rollout three weeks later. Expect demo kits, counter displays, and a training video from Petra's group before month-end. Keep chatter outside the company to zero until the press date. Here's the confidential piece on where this fits in our broader plans.

confidential, yahip-hagug: Gorixax Logistics plans to lower the Ulaael list price by 26.6 percent in October. The pricing group signed off on a budget of $199.9 million for Project Holix. The renewal with Kasdorox Systems closes at $137.5 million a year, 8.2 percent above the last contract. Project Lamion slips by a full year because of the audit delay.

### Step 4: Verify engine settings

After migrating Cartwright Rules (shipping-fee engine) to v5, confirm no permissive defaults survived. Audit logging must stay on; anonymous rule uploads must stay off. TLS is enforced at the broker, not the app. Compare the deployed state against the expected configuration listed below.

settings of fafog-haduf:
ZORIX_PIN=4648
ZORIX_METRICS_HOST=metrics.zorix.paliqsys.corp
ZORIX_LOG_LEVEL=info
ZORIX_TENANT=druix